On Mon, Aug 13, 2012 at 12:45:50PM +0200, Daniel Cegiełka wrote:
> 2012/8/13 Rich Felker <dalias@aerifal.cx>:
> > On Sun, Aug 12, 2012 at 08:26:24PM -0400, idunham@lavabit.com wrote:
> >> Out of curiosity, is PAM excluded from consideration? Does it require a
> >> dynamically-loaded library?
> >
> > PAM is not an implementation of the user database. It's for
> > authenticating logins. Completely different problem domain.
>
> A bit off topic: Is the traditional PAM/shadow will be supported in
> musl? I would like to use full PAM/shadow/tcb stack from the Owl
> with musl (+owl's pam modules). If not, what would be an alternative proposal?
It's intended that these libraries work on musl, but I'm not aware of
whether they do yet or not. I think tcb wants the gensalt stuff in
libc, so that probably won't work without some patching.
